The Nigeria international struggled for game time in Italy before ending his nightmare with a move to the UAE giants.

United Arab Emirates giants Al Wasl FC have officially announced the signing of Nigerian striker Isaac Success, 28, as a foreign player to bolster the team’s lineup for the 2024-2025 sports season.

Pulse Sports reports that the former Udinese forward will wear the shirt number 90 as he joins the ranks of the Emperor.

Success brings a wealth of experience from European football, having played for notable clubs such as Udinese in Italy, Granada FC and Málaga FC in Spain, and Watford in England.

His impressive career includes being the top goal scorer at the Under-17 Africa Cup and winning the Under-17 World Cup in 2013 with Nigeria.

In a statement reflecting his excitement about joining Al Wasl, Success who tied the knot recently said, “I am looking forward to meeting you [the fans], and I hope we can achieve great things together.”

His arrival is expected to enhance Al Wasl's attacking options as they aim for success in domestic and regional competitions.

Success's career has seen him make significant contributions across various leagues, with a total of six goals and 17 assists in 83 appearances for Udinese.

His versatility allows him to play effectively as a center-forward or on the wings, making him a valuable addition to Al Wasl's squad.

The club’s management expressed confidence in Success's ability to make an immediate impact, stating that his experience and skill set align well with their ambitions for the upcoming season.

Success’s decision to leave Europe comes after a struggle to establish himself at Udinese where he only managed 30 starts in two season, nine of which were last season.
